What Should I Do Right After Spilling Water On A MacBook?

Updated: Apr 13, 2023


macbook

Spilling water or other liquids on your device can be a disastrous experience. Whether it’s your smartphone, laptop, or tablet, having liquid spilt on it can cause concern. The fluid can cause damage to the internal components of your device and can lead to malfunctioning or failure.

It’s essential to take the necessary steps to prevent liquid spills from occurring in the first place. However, since accidents happen, there will always be an instance wherein people will spill on their MacBooks. But what should I do after spilling water? Here are some ideas.

1. Disconnect From Power

First, people should immediately turn off their devices and disconnect them from any power source. It will help minimise the risk of any electrical shock or damage to the internal components of your device. As a result, the water will not damage the entire system instantly.

It also helps to turn off the device immediately. Aside from disconnecting it from the power source, people should also avoid using it for a while. Since the battery is also a power source, turning the device on will damage the system through electric shocks.

2. Move to a Dry Space

After disconnecting the device from the power source, people should move it to a dry space as soon as possible. It will help prevent further damage to the internal components caused by the water. It also helps to reduce the risk of corrosion or other issues when left in a damp environment.

People should also remove accessories or covers from the device to ensure no water is trapped inside. It is essential if the device is submerged in water. However, if no accessories are attached to the MacBook, then moving it to a dry space should be enough.

3. Dry As Much Liquid

Once the device is in a dry environment, people should use a soft cloth or towel to dry as much liquid as possible from the device's exterior. It is essential to be gentle and avoid using any abrasive material to prevent scratching the surface of the MacBook.

People should also use a vacuum cleaner to remove liquid trapped in the device's vents or ports. It will help avoid any further damage caused by the fluid. However, never consider burying the device in rice, which is the typical response after spilling water on any device.

4. Check For Damage

Once the device has been dried and cleaned, it is time to check for any damage caused by the liquid. People should check all ports, buttons, and cables for any signs of wear and corrosion. If any damage is found, it must be repaired as soon as possible to avoid any further damage.

Furthermore, people should also check the battery and the logic board for any signs of corrosion. If there is any visible damage, it is best to get it repaired by a certified technician. But if there are none, leave it be for a while before turning it on again.

5. Leave to Dry For 48 Hours

Once the device has been checked for damage, leaving it to dry for at least 48 hours before turning it back on is essential. It will ensure that all the liquid has evaporated and the device is entirely safe.

Leaving the device in a well-ventilated area is also essential, as this will help the drying process. In addition, people should also avoid exposing the device to direct sunlight as this could cause further damage.
